/**
* An object based once plugin (similar to jquery.once, but without the DOM).
*
* @param {String} id
* A unique identifier.
* @param {Function} callback
* The callback to invoke if the identifier has not yet been seen.
*
* @return {Bootstrap}
*/
Bootstrap.once = function (id, callback) {
// Immediately return if identifier has already been processed.
if (this.processedOnce[id]) {
return this;
}
callback.call(this, this.settings);
this.processedOnce[id] = true;
return this;
};
/**
* Provide jQuery UI like ability to get/set options for Bootstrap plugins.
*
* @param {string|object} key
* A string value of the option to set, can be dot like to a nested key.
* An object of key/value pairs.
* @param {*} [value]
* (optional) A value to set for key.
*
* @returns {*}
* - Returns nothing if key is an object or both key and value parameters
* were provided to set an option.
* - Returns the a value for a specific setting if key was provided.
* - Returns an object of key/value pairs of all the options if no key or
* value parameter was provided.
*
* @see https://github.com/jquery/jquery-ui/blob/master/ui/widget.js
*/
Bootstrap.option = function (key, value) {
var options = $.isPlainObject(key) ? $.extend({}, key) : {};
// Get all options (clone so it doesn't reference the internal object).
if (arguments.length === 0) {
return $.extend({}, this.options);
}
// Get/set single option.
if (typeof key === "string") {
// Handle nested keys in dot notation.
// e.g., "foo.bar" => { foo: { bar: true } }
var parts = key.split('.');
key = parts.shift();
var obj = options;
if (parts.length) {
for (var i = 0; i < parts.length - 1; i++) {
obj[parts[i]] = obj[parts[i]] || {};
obj = obj[parts[i]];
}
key = parts.pop();
}
// Get.
if (arguments.length === 1) {
return obj[key] === void 0 ? null : obj[key];
}
// Set.
obj[key] = value;
}
// Set multiple options.
$.extend(true, this.options, options);
};

/**
* Simulates a native event on an element in the browser.
*
* Note: This is a fairly complete modern implementation. If things aren't
* working quite the way you intend (in older browsers), you may wish to use
* the jQuery.simulate plugin. If it's available, this method will defer to
* that plugin.
*
* @see https://github.com/jquery/jquery-simulate
*
* @param {HTMLElement|jQuery} element
* A DOM element to dispatch event on. Note: this may be a jQuery object,
* however be aware that this will trigger the same event for each element
* inside the jQuery collection; use with caution.
* @param {String|String[]} type
* The type(s) of event to simulate.
* @param {Object} [options]
* An object of options to pass to the event constructor. Typically, if
* an event is being proxied, you should just pass the original event
* object here. This allows, if the browser supports it, to be a truly
* simulated event.
*
* @return {Boolean}
* The return value is false if event is cancelable and at least one of the
* event handlers which handled this event called Event.preventDefault().
* Otherwise it returns true.
*/
Bootstrap.simulate = function (element, type, options) {
// Handle jQuery object wrappers so it triggers on each element.
var ret = true;
if (element instanceof $) {
element.each(function () {
if (!Bootstrap.simulate(this, type, options)) {
ret = false;
}
});
return ret;
}
if (!(element instanceof HTMLElement)) {
this.fatal('Passed element must be an instance of HTMLElement, got "@type" instead.', {
'@type': typeof element,
});
}
// Defer to the jQuery.simulate plugin, if it's available.
if (typeof $.simulate === 'function') {
new $.simulate(element, type, options);
return true;
}
var event;
var ctor;
var types = [].concat(type);
for (var i = 0, l = types.length; i < l; i++) {
type = types[i];
for (var name in this.eventMap) {
if (this.eventMap[name].test(type)) {
ctor = name;
break;
}
}
if (!ctor) {
throw new SyntaxError('Only rudimentary HTMLEvents, KeyboardEvents and MouseEvents are supported: ' + type);
}
var opts = {bubbles: true, cancelable: true};
if (ctor === 'KeyboardEvent' || ctor === 'MouseEvent') {
$.extend(opts, {ctrlKey: !1, altKey: !1, shiftKey: !1, metaKey: !1});
}
if (ctor === 'MouseEvent') {
$.extend(opts, {button: 0, pointerX: 0, pointerY: 0, view: window});
}
if (options) {
$.extend(opts, options);
}
if (typeof window[ctor] === 'function') {
event = new window[ctor](type, opts);
if (!element.dispatchEvent(event)) {
ret = false;
}
}
else if (document.createEvent) {
event = document.createEvent(ctor);
event.initEvent(type, opts.bubbles, opts.cancelable);
if (!element.dispatchEvent(event)) {
ret = false;
}
}
else if (typeof element.fireEvent === 'function') {
event = $.extend(document.createEventObject(), opts);
if (!element.fireEvent('on' + type, event)) {
ret = false;
}
}
else if (typeof element[type]) {
element[type]();
}
}
return ret;
};
